OK, so this is a "weird" one for me. It's veterans days on sunday and a local car wash was offering a free wash, on Sat for both the exterior and interior. I dropped by and received both, they did a great job BTW. However now it seems like the radio won't turn off, so after parking on Sat, I went to start it today and the battery was dead?

Any thoughts or ideas? before I head to the dealer

I did have 2 recalls done, and and the rear control arm bushing changed on Friday? however the radio issue started after I left the car wash and went to Costco.

So troops a bit of an "update" after a couple of days at the dealer the problem was a failed relay, apparently something in the "upfitter" portion of the vehicle, the relay stayed open, drawing about 3 amps while the engine was off. So overall a $20 part and 2hrs of labour, you do the math :( .
